You asked: **"Is Google Drive OCR using Google Documents or Google Vision?"** **Answer**: I initially implemented the **Drive API** (using Documents conversion), but **Vision API** is actually what you want! ## What I Built for You ### 3 Complete OCR Solutions: 1. **✅ Tesseract** (Already Working!) - 85% confidence on your test documents - Completely free, runs locally - NO handwriting support 2. **✅ Google Drive API** (Implemented) - Uses Docs conversion as a workaround - Free unlimited - Handwriting support ✅ - Slow (4-6 seconds/page) 3. **✅ Google Cloud Vision API** (Recommended!) - **THIS is the real Google OCR API** - **1,000 pages/month FREE** - **3x faster** (1-2 seconds/page) - Handwriting support ✅ - Per-word confidence scores - Bounding boxes for highlighting ## Why Vision API > Drive API Both use the same OCR engine, but: | Feature | Drive API | Vision API | |---------|-----------|------------| | Speed | 4.2s ⭐⭐ | 1.8s ⭐⭐⭐⭐ | | Free tier | Unlimited | 1,000/month | | Confidence | Estimated | Per-word | | Page-by-page | ❌ No | ✅ Yes | | How it works | Workaround | Official API | ## Cost Reality Check **Vision API Free Tier: 1,000 pages/month** Real-world examples: - Small marina (50 docs/month): **$0** - Medium dealership (500 docs/month): **$0** - Large operation (5,000 docs/month): **$6/month** - Enterprise (50,000 docs/month): **$73/month** **For most users, it's effectively free!** ## What to Do ### Option 1: Start with Vision API (Recommended) ```bash # 1.
